Analysis

Serbia recorded 42.57 million current LCU per square kilometre for general government total expenditure (current lcu), per square in 2023. That is the highest value across all 18 years on record.

The figure is up 16.0% on the previous year and up 113.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, general government total expenditure (current lcu), per square in Serbia peaked at 42.57 million current LCU per square kilometre in 2023 and was at its lowest, 10.56 million current LCU per square kilometre, in 2006.

That places Serbia 34th out of 195 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 18 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

General government total expenditure (current LCU)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

General government total expenditure (current LCU)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
